LOCATION: Washington DC
DESCRIPTION OF ROLE: This position is contingent on award notification.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provide speechwriting support for government customers to include development of message to align initiatives with those of the Secretary of the Navy, Chief of Naval Operations and the Office of Legislative Affairs.
- Provide support for the development of strategic communications documents.
Must Haves:
- Bachelor of Art / Science degree in Communications or Journalism or related field.
- Minimum of 10 years of experience as a speechwriter.
- Experience as a military speechwriter (Echelon I or II level preferred).
- Experience with NAVSEA, naval history, heritage and traditions.
- Experience with the Navy and Defense issues and current events. Speech writer shall work directly with senior leaders to develop themes and messaging that aligns to and complements their speaking style.
- Demonstrated experience writing speeches for senior defense and/or military industry leaders.
- Demonstrated record of excellence in communication skills, both written and oral, to produce concise and properly edited products that clearly and logically convey complex information and ideas.
